chr8-22554531-C-T

Variant summary

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_005775.5(SORBS3):​c.25C>T​(p.Arg9Cys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000141 in 1,612,620 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
SORBS3 (HGNC:30907): (sorbin and SH3 domain containing 3) This gene encodes an SH3 domain-containing adaptor protein. The presence of SH3 domains play a role in this protein's ability to bind other cytoplasmic molecules and contribute to cystoskeletal organization, cell adhesion and migration, signaling, and gene expression.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Nov 2011]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sMar 08, 2024The c.25C>T (p.R9C) alteration is located in exon 2 (coding exon 1) of the SORBS3 gene. This alteration results from a C to T substitution at nucleotide position 25, causing the arginine (R) at amino acid position 9 to be replaced by a cysteine (C).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
